Just letting people in the greater Wellington area know that I've got most of the drivers written on my ARM 32 bit microcontroller based controller board, and I'm getting close to being able to run g-codes.

If anybody's interested, this hardware base is pretty versatile and without many of the limitations of the current reprap generation equipment.

I'm not doing any work to perfect the mechanics at this stage, my current focus is software.
